/**
* EDR run-number pairs, keyed by the odd EXPORT run (Ethiopia → Djibouti). The
* even IMPORT run (Djibouti → Ethiopia) is fixed by the export run.
*
* Run numbers are always 4 digits (8401, never 84001). Pairs are listed out
* rather than computed from the 8001/+100/+1 pattern, so a run that ever breaks
* the convention stays correct here.
*
* SeedWagonRunNumbers2280000000000 carries its own frozen copy on purpose: a
* migration must keep doing what it did when it was applied, whereas this list
* is live config for the update script. Add or retire runs HERE.
*/
export const TRAIN_RUN_PAIRS: Record<string, string> = {
'8001': '8002',
'8101': '8102',
'8201': '8202',
'8301': '8302',
'8401': '8402',
'8501': '8502',
'8601': '8602',
'8701': '8702',
'8801': '8802',
'8901': '8902',
'9001': '9002',
};
/** Even IMPORT run -> its odd EXPORT run. Derived so the two cannot drift. */
export const EXPORT_BY_IMPORT: Record<string, string> = Object.fromEntries(
Object.entries(TRAIN_RUN_PAIRS).map(([exportRun, importRun]) => [importRun, exportRun]),
);
/**
* Normalise any run number to its EXPORT run. Accepts either half of a pair, so
* a sheet listing "8002" and one listing "8001" both resolve to the same train.
* Returns null when the number belongs to no known run.
*/
export const toExportRun = (run: string): string | null => {
const value = run.trim();
if (TRAIN_RUN_PAIRS[value]) return value;
return EXPORT_BY_IMPORT[value] ?? null;
};
